Description

As a part of Microsoft AI platform responsible for providing an efficient runtime and end-to-end application for state-of-the-art (SOTA) AI models that powers the world both within (including co-pilots) and third party applications.

Our team delivers scalable LLM (Large Language Models) inferencing in cost efficient manner for speech, vision and text (multimodal) inputs. Our services are based on Kubernetes based scalable compute on both CPU and GPUs. We also deliver SOTA performance in delivering (near-) real time model personalization.

Design and implement high performance microservice components, algorithms and integration with other services to deliver scalable API, offline containers as well as libraries for Microsoft Office and Azure Open AI services. 

Innovate and bring cutting edge solutions to run AI models at scale ranging from core runtime enhancement using batching, intelligent data packing, parameter efficient inferencing, orchestrating between different AI components. Trouble shoot system level live services, offline container performance across data centers Improve the quality of model inference by reducing latency, running models on novel human-like neural network engine as well as traditional GPUs Implement telemetry and logging to measure performance metrics on GPUs, define new metrics and optimize model inferencing
